    Wordpress redirection

    I noticed a strange thing on WP installations. It makes a big redirection from
    http : //www.mysite.com to http : //mysite.com where it is installed. It happens not only on subdomains or aliased addon domains but also on main domains. What do you think about? How bad is this for SEO? How can i fix it?

    Not tried this myself, but apparently if you wish to use www follow these instructions

    Login to your WordPress Dashboard
    Click on "Settings"
    Now, click on "General"
    Modify both of the below settings to include www
    Blog address (URL)
    WordPress address (URL)
